West Valley lost against Wenatchee back in March,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Friday. The Rams fell just short of the Panthers by a score of 2-1. While losing is never fun, West Valley can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Washington soccer rankings (they are ranked 187th, while Wenatchee are ranked 16th).
This is the second loss in a row for West Valley and nudges their season record down to 2-9. As for Wenatchee, their victory was their fifth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 8-1.
We've got plenty of inter-district action coming up soon. West Valley is set to face off against their familiar foe Eisenhower at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Meanwhile, Wenatchee will square off against rival Moses Lake at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
